1a Travelling from Ankara (Turkey) to Istanbul (Turkey)
Travel from Ankara to Istanbul by direct high-speed-train. The journey time is 4:30 hours. The train ticket prices start from 75 TRY (9 EUR) in 2nd class and 105 TRY in 1st class (12 EUR).
On the train journey from Ankara to Istanbul you will travel by a "Yüksek Hızlı Tren" (YHT) high-speed-train with a top-speed of 250 km/h. There are at least six train connections daily. The travel distance is 530 kilometres. You have to be at the train platform at least 15 minutes before departure due to X-ray scan of your luggage.
The deparutre station is Ankara central railway station.
The arrival train stations are "Istanbul Pendik" and "Istanbul Söğütlüçeşme". You reach "Sirkeci" station by Marmaray suburban train from "Söğütlüçeşme" station. Frequent trains every 10 minutes. The journey time is 10 minutes for a ticket fare of less than 1 EUR.
"Istanbul Haydarpaşa" is under construction and maybe the YHT will start from there as well one day.

1b Travelling from Istanbul (Turkey) to Thessaloniki (Greece)
Travel from Turkey to Greece by bus. There exists no direct train connection anymore. If you want to travel by train, travel from Istanbul to Sofia (Bulgaria) and from there to Thessaloniki. But it takes a lot more time than by bus.
There are several direct (overnight) bus connections available from Istanbul (Turkey) to bigger Greek cities (Athens, Thessaloniki, ...). Find bus and train schedules via the booking links provided.
The bus journey time from Istanbul to Thessaloniki is 10 hours. Buy your bus ticket for this travel route from 45 EUR.

1d Travelling from Patras (Greece) to Ancona (Italy)
Travel from Patras to Ancona by ferry. The journey time is 22 hours. The ticket price starts at 70 EUR. The ferry companies Superfast Ferries, ANEK Lines and Grimaldi Lines serve this route.
You will find these service categories on board of the ferry:
- seats: standard inclinable seats which are the cheapest travel option
- shared cabins with beds: you share the cabin and the shower and toilet with other travellers.
- private cabins: from standard to luxury cabins with private bed, shower and toilet. This is the best option if you want privacy, travel with your family or friends.
The check-in time is two hours prior to departure.
How to get in Patras from the the train station to the ferry port:
You have to get from the railway station to the „New Port“ of Patras, which is 2 kilometres in the south of the railway station. Either walk within 30 minutes along the promenade or use the bus line number 18. It is a journey time of 10 minutes with hourly departures. The bus ticket price is 1,20 EUR.
In Patras you have a second port: the North Port which serves ferry routes to the Ionian Sea. Take bus line 18 or walk from there to the railway station within 10 minutes. The railway station is in the middle of both ports.
How to get in Ancona from the ferry port to the train station:
It is a distance of 2 kilometres from Ancona ferry port to the railway station. You can either walk which will take about 30 minutes. Or you travel by bus line number 12 or 20. Frequent departures are available. The bus journey time is 10 minutes. You will depart from „Ancona Ferries Terminal“, the arrival place of all ferry companies. The bus ticket price is 1.50 EUR. Show your boarding pass and you may travel for free.

1e Travelling from Ancona (Italy) to Monte Carlo (Monaco)
To travel by train from Italy to Monaco first travel by Italian trains to the Italian-French border at Ventimiglia. There you change to a regional train to Monaco.
